Well a disappointing weekend! 10 did not open. 15 meters was poor Saturday, better Sunday. 20 meters was about all that was workable Saturday. Sunday morning 15 was the band to be on 20 meters was not very good. 20 did open Sunday afternoon. I did quit early because the band seemed to flop about 2230 also it looked like were were going to get a storm but we didn't just rain. My last QSO was a QTC exchange at 2238.
I again noted a QTC issue with N1MM, a bug I reported in the CW contest that was not addressed. I reported it again yesterday, and apparently this time I was not the only one who noted it as there were a bunch of complaints about it on the N1MM discussion list. I also saw a message from one of the programmers who said that he knows about it but has not had a chance to look at it yet. I was able to "fool" N1MM to give out all my QTCs, but I just hope that it calculated my score correctly. The Contest Robot may have something to say about that though.
